Government Spending
The total amount of money expended by a government on various sectors, including infrastructure, education, defense, and social services.
Net Exports
The difference between a country's total exports of goods and services and its total imports of goods and services over a specified period.

Solow
Refers to the Solow-Swan model, an economic model of long-term economic growth set within the framework of neoclassical economics that illustrates how a country's level of capital stock, labor force, and technology can affect its total output or GDP.
